Megan Khang is one of the most respected and consistent performers on the LPGA Tour, known for her perseverance and historic representation as the first LPGA player of Hmong descent. She was born in Brockton, Massachusetts, United States. Her journey from junior golf prodigy to Solheim Cup regular reflects discipline, resilience, and steady career growth.
Born on October 23, 1997, in Brockton, Massachusetts, Khang learned golf from her father and rose quickly through junior and amateur ranks. After years of near misses, she finally secured her breakthrough LPGA victory in 2023, cementing her place among the game’s elite.
Early Life and Golf Background
Megan Khang grew up in Rockland, Massachusetts, in a close-knit family with roots in Laos. Her parents were refugees from the Vietnam War who immigrated to the United States in the 1970s. Golf became a central part of her childhood, with her father playing a pivotal role in developing her fundamentals and competitive mindset.
Her talent was evident early. At just 14 years old, Khang qualified for the 2012 U.S. Women’s Open, a rare feat that placed her among the nation’s most promising junior golfers. She went on to win multiple junior tournaments and represented the United States at the 2015 Junior Solheim Cup.
Professional Career Overview
Khang turned professional in 2016 after finishing T-6 at the LPGA Final Qualifying Tournament in 2015, earning her LPGA Tour card. Remarkably, she has maintained full LPGA status every season since, a testament to her consistency and durability.
After numerous top-10 finishes and close calls, her perseverance paid off in August 2023, when she captured her first LPGA Tour victory at the CPKC Women’s Open, defeating Ko Jin-young in a playoff. The win came in her 191st LPGA start, making it one of the most celebrated breakthrough moments in recent LPGA history.
She is also a four-time United States Solheim Cup team member, underlining her value in elite team competition.

Megan Khang Achievements and Career Highlights
Major Achievements
LPGA Tour Winner (1): CPKC Women’s Open (2023)
Four-time U.S. Solheim Cup Team Member
Qualified for the U.S. Women’s Open at age 14
Maintained continuous LPGA Tour status since 2016
First LPGA Tour player of Hmong descent
Notable Amateur Wins
2012 Northern Junior Championship
2013 PING Invitational
2013 Faldo Series Grand Final
2014 Faldo Series Grand Final
2014 Doral-Publix Junior Classic
2015 Eastern Amateur Championship
Her amateur résumé laid the foundation for one of the steadiest professional careers on the LPGA Tour.
